Kerala couple ties knot at hospital after groom tests COVID positive, bride wears PPE kit ANI | Updated: Apr 25, 2021 22:08 IST
Alappuzha (Kerala) [India], April 25 (ANI): Amid the distressing visuals of the COVID-19 cases from hospitals across the country, a rare occasion in a Kerala hospital offered a moment to rejoice.
A couple tied knots at Alappuzha Medical College and Hospital on Sunday. The thing that made the marriage unique was the bride s outfit. Instead of traditional clothes, the bride wore a PPE kit as the bridegroom had tested positive for COVID-19. The wedding took place at the hospital with the permission of the District Collector.

Alappuzha (Kerala), April 22 (IANS) Lokame Tharavadu , a major contemporary art show featuring 267 artists and over 3,000 art works including assemblages and installations that began last week in Alappuzha, has the potential to transform the dynamics of cultural tourism, according to tourism stakeholders and planners.
